Round trip latency for a C-Band satellite is just under 500 milliseconds, so every practical connection will be between 600 and 700ms minimum.
Games aren't workable over such connections, but the good news is that we are scheduled to get a submarine fiber installed next year with a link to Anchorage and then south on existing fiber. In addition fiber to Asia and Europe will be added within 3 to 5 years. When that happens Barrow will have lower latency to just about anywhere than just about anyone!
Currently local Internet access is offered by GCI (the long distance and cable TV company) and by ASTAC (local telco). Both also offer cell phone service too. Generally I would recommend GCI, but if you are particular about cell service and want a package deal you'll need to compare the cell phone deals very carefully. On the other hand if you want cable tv you'll definitely want to include everything you can in a deal with GCI.
